A Dana Point home featuring aquatic elements in its three-level rotunda design is on the market in Monarch Beach’s guard-gated Ritz Cove neighborhood.

The asking price is $22.55 million.

Built in 2009 on 75 bedrock-deep caissons, the 7,681-square-foot house offers five bedrooms and eight bathrooms. County records indicate the property last sold in March 2004 for $5.1 million.
